What Are Life Cycle?

Similarly, What is a life cycle your answer?

The developmental phases that occur throughout an organism’s lifespan are referred to as a life cycle. Plants and animals have three main phases in their life cycles: a fertilized egg or seed, an immature juvenile, and an adult.

People also ask, Why is life a cycle?

Individual creatures die and are replaced by new ones, ensuring the species’ longevity. An organism goes through physical changes throughout its life cycle that enable it to mature and reproduce new organisms. These changes may be classified into phases of development since they occur often within a species.

What is project life cycle?

The processes necessary for project managers to effectively manage a project from inception to conclusion are outlined in the project life cycle. The project life cycle (also known as the 5 process groups) contains five phases: initiating, planning, executing, monitoring/controlling, and closing.

What is the difference between life cycle and lifespan?

A person’s life cycle is a set of changes that occur throughout his or her life. The length of time that an organism lives is referred to as its life span. It is the temporal span from conception to natural death.

What is the average age of death?

Life expectancy at birth in the United States is 77.3 years, with males living 74.5 years and women living 80.2 years, according to the most current statistics available from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.

What’s the lifespan of a person?

In 2020, similar nations’ average life expectancy at birth was 82.1 years, down 0.5 years from 2019.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, life expectancy at birth in the United States fell to 77 years in 2020, down 1.8 years from 78.8 years in 2019.
